Guest mikeygee Posted April 7, 2011 Report Posted April 7, 2011 I seem to have a problem... i just got an Acer Liquid E , got Malez Recovery working but then after flashing the phones bin... whenever i try to go into Malez Recovery I get stuck at a screen where its an ! mark with a small android... how do I get back in Malez Recovery so I can flash a custom ROM?

Guest Splux Posted April 7, 2011 Report Posted April 7, 2011 I seem to have a problem... i just got an Acer Liquid E , got Malez Recovery working but then after flashing the phones bin... whenever i try to go into Malez Recovery I get stuck at a screen where its an ! mark with a small android... how do I get back in Malez Recovery so I can flash a custom ROM? When you flash a new *.bin it flashes the recovery too, so reflash malez and you will be able to boot to recovery again :D
